Title: The Innovative Journey of Bernard Besson

Introduction

Bernard Besson is a notable inventor hailing from Villeurbanne, France. With a total of four patents to his name, Besson has made significant contributions to the fields of chemistry and material science. His inventions primarily revolve around the preparation of alpha-hydroxy acids and novel catalysts, demonstrating his deep understanding of chemical processes and innovation.

Latest Patents

Among his latest patents, Besson has developed a process for preparing alpha-hydroxycarboxylic acids. This process involves the reaction of an organic halide with carbon monoxide and a hydrogen donor compound, facilitated by a carbonylation catalyst and an inorganic base, at a temperature of at least 90 degrees Celsius. Furthermore, he has designed novel dinuclear and water-soluble rhodium complexes that serve as effective hydroformylation catalysts. These compounds have a general formula where R and R' can form a single divalent radical, and they incorporate sulfonated triarylphosphine ligands, as well as carbonyl or TAPS ligands, showcasing Besson's innovative approach to catalysis.

Career Highlights

Throughout his career, Bernard Besson has worked with prestigious companies such as Rhône-Poulenc Chimie de Base and Rhône-Poulenc Spécialités Chimiques. His experience in these organizations has provided him with a robust platform to explore and develop his innovative ideas, especially in the chemical manufacturing sector.

Collaborations

Besson has collaborated with esteemed colleagues in his field, including Philippe Kalck and Alain Thorez. These collaborations have facilitated the sharing of ideas and advancements, further enhancing his work and contributions to the industry.
